Albany, NY -- (SBWIRE) -- 07/12/2017 -- HIV-associated lipodystrophy is associated with HIV infection or due to side effects of drugs used for HIV infection. The HIV-associated lipodystrophy clusters different clinical conditions, which are lipoaccumulation and lipoatrophy. While lipoaccumulation is associated with increase in visceral fat, lipoatrophy is related to subcutaneous fat loss.
